Pono e hoʻomaopopo ʻia he nui nā kikoʻī a me nā hoʻonohonoho o nā kānana inlet. Ma waho aʻe o ka hoʻokō ʻana i nā koi o ke kahe kahe (pumping speed), pono e noʻonoʻo ʻia ka maikaʻi a me ke kūpaʻa wela. ʻO nā mea kānana maʻamau ka pepa a me ka polyester. ʻIke loa, ʻaʻole kūpono lākou no nā wahi wela kiʻekiʻe. A he kiʻekiʻe ko lākou fineness, kānana 5, 3, 1 a me 0.6 microns pauka. E hoʻokō ʻole ia i ke degere vacuum. ʻAʻole kūʻē wale nā mea kānana kila kila i ka wela kiʻekiʻe a me ka corrosion, akā loaʻa nō hoʻi ka fineness haʻahaʻa. ʻOi aku ia ma ka laina me nā koi o ke kaʻina sintering vacuum. No laila, koho ʻia nā mea kānana kuhili ʻole no ke kaʻina sintering vacuum.
ʻO ka Vacuum Sintering kahi ʻano o ka hoʻopaʻa ʻana i ke kino porcelain ma lalo o nā kūlana ʻā. Aia i loko o ke kino porcelain ka nui o nā pores. Hiki i ka mahu, ka hydrogen a me ka oxygen ke pakele mai nā pores i pani ʻia ma o ka hoʻoheheʻe ʻana a me ka diffusion; ʻAʻole maʻalahi ka paʻa ʻana o carbon dioxide a me ka nitrogen mai nā pores i pani ʻia ma muli o ko lākou haʻahaʻa haʻahaʻa, ka hopena i nā pores i ka huahana a hoʻemi ʻia. Inā hoʻopaʻa ʻia ke kino porcelain ma lalo o ke ʻano maloʻo, e pakele nā kinoea a pau mai nā pores ma mua o ka pau ʻana. No laila ʻaʻole i loko o ka huahana nā pores, no laila e hoʻomaikaʻi ai i ka density o ka huahana.
